New Year's Babies

1 January 2011

Thus far, clinics and hospitals have reported that 42 babies have been born in the Western Cape on New Year's Day. There were 22 boys born and 20 girls.

The first baby born in the Western Cape on New Year's Day was at Oudsthoorn Hospital, to a mother from Prince Albert. The baby girl weighed 2 880 g and was born at 00:12am.

The earliest baby born in Cape Town on New Year's Day was born at 00:20am at Macassar Midwives Obstretics Unit. The baby girl weighed 3 360 g.

Another baby girl was born at George Hospital at 00:30am. She weighed 3 440 g.

The Western Cape's first baby boy was born at Mowbray Maternity Hospital at 00:48am. He weighed 1 180 g.
